What are jobs in the music industry?

Music industry jobs involve music marketing, management, production, performance, or education. A record label may employ music business professionals to market music, choose which artists to promote, create marketing strategies, or manage talent. Production positions include music producers, studio technicians, and recording artists. A recording artist may also perform with the help of a concert promoter, agent, and concert support staff such as stagehands. Music education teachers and coaches provide education and support for students and established artists. Some coaches may train students on a specific instrument or musical genre.

What are some typical challenges musicians face when collaborating with other artists or bands?

Musicians often encounter challenges such as aligning creative visions, managing differing work styles, and coordinating schedules when collaborating with others. Effective communication and flexibility are key to overcoming these hurdles and producing cohesive work. Additionally, musicians must often navigate contractual agreements and division of royalties, which requires a good understanding of music industry practices. Building strong professional relationships and being open to feedback can greatly enhance collaborative experiences.

What is the difference between Music vs Music Therapist?

AspectMusicMusic Therapist
Required CredentialsNone or basic music educationMusic degree + certification (e.g., MT-BC)
Work EnvironmentStudios, stages, personal settingsHospitals, clinics, schools
Industry UsagePerformance, composition, teachingHealthcare, therapy, rehabilitation
Common Search IntentMusic careers, performance jobsTherapeutic music roles, healthcare jobs

Music involves performance, composition, and teaching, often in entertainment or education settings. Music therapists use music as a therapeutic tool to improve clients' mental and physical health, requiring specialized training and certification. While both roles involve music, their work environments, credentials, and industry applications differ significantly.

What careers are there in music?

Careers in music include roles such as musician, singer, composer, music producer, sound engineer, music teacher, and music therapist. These jobs often require skills in performance, audio technology, music theory, and sometimes certifications or degrees in music or related fields. Opportunities exist in live performance, recording studios, education, and entertainment industries.
